Abstract

The embodiment of the invention discloses a safety signboard, which comprises a marking panel, wherein two ends of the marking panel are respectively provided with a hanging hole, the two hanging holes are connected through a hanging rope, a signboard logo is printed on the front surface of the marking panel, and the back surface of the marking panel is connected with a magnet strip for fixing with a magnetic surface and a movable sucker component for fixing with a non-magnetic surface; according to the embodiment of the invention, the marking panel is provided with the hanging rope, the magnet strip and the movable sucker assembly, so that the movable sucker assembly is suitable for hanging a hook, is also suitable for magnetic attraction of a magnetic surface and is also suitable for vacuum adsorption of a non-magnetic surface; when the position to be fixed of the marking panel is not provided with a proper flat adsorption surface for the suction disc to adsorb, the position of the marking panel can be kept unchanged due to the movable characteristic of the suction disc assembly, the adsorption surface can be freely selected, and the practicability of the marking panel is further enhanced.

Detailed Description
The present invention is described in terms of particular embodiments, other advantages and features of the invention will become apparent to those skilled in the art from the following disclosure, and it is to be understood that the described embodiments are merely exemplary of the invention and that it is not intended to limit the invention to the particular embodiments disclosed.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
As shown in FIG. 1, the present invention provides a safety signboard, which comprises an indication panel 10, wherein two ends of the indication panel 10 are respectively provided with a hanging hole 13, the two hanging holes 13 are connected through a hanging rope 20, a signboard logo is printed on the front surface of the indication panel 10, and the back surface of the indication panel 10 is connected with a magnet strip 30 for fixing with a magnetic surface and a movable suction disc assembly 40 for fixing with a non-magnetic surface.
Based on the existing structure of the safety signboard, the embodiment of the invention is characterized in that the suspension mode of the indication panel 10 is diversified, and the indication panel 10 is provided with the hanging rope 20, the magnet strip 30 and the movable sucker assembly 40, so that the safety signboard is suitable for hanging hooks, magnetic attraction on a magnetic surface and vacuum adsorption on a non-magnetic surface.
When the position to be fixed of the indication panel 10 has no proper flat adsorption surface for the suction disc to adsorb, the position of the indication panel 10 can be kept unchanged due to the movable characteristic of the movable suction disc assembly 40, the adsorption surface of the suction disc can be freely selected, and the practicability of the indication panel is further enhanced.
The movable suction cup assemblies 40 are provided with four movable suction cup assemblies 40 respectively arranged at four corners of the indication panel 10, and each movable suction cup assembly 40 comprises an automatic contraction rope device 41 fixedly connected with the indication panel 10 and a suction cup 42 connected with a stretching end of the automatic contraction box device 41. The fixed position of the display panel 10 is fixed by the pulling action of the automatic retraction rope arrangement 41 and the suction cups 42 in the four moveable suction cup assemblies 40.
Further, as shown in fig. 3, the automatic contraction rope device 41 includes a box 411, an elastic reel 412 installed inside the box 411, and a contraction rope 413 wound on the elastic reel 412, the top of the box 411 is fixed on the back of the indication panel 10, a wire outlet 414 is opened on the side of the box 411, and a stretching end of the contraction rope 413 extends along the wire outlet 414 and is connected to the suction cup 42.
The automatic retracting case device 41 is similar to the conventional tape measure and the automatic fishing handle rope used in fishing operation, and the retracting rope 413 is pulled to drive the retracting rope 413 to extend from the outlet 414, and the retracting rope 413 is released to automatically retract into the case 411.
In order to fix the stretched length of the contraction string 413 and prevent the suction cup 41 from being pulled by the retracting force of the contraction string 413, the suction cup 41 is preferably provided with a clip 415 for fixing the length of the outlet line at the outlet 414.
As shown in fig. 4, the suction cup 42 includes a cup support 421, a cup 422 and a pull rod 423, the cup 422 is disposed at the bottom of the cup support 421, the cup support 421 is connected to the stretching end of the automatic shrinking box 41, one end of the pull rod 423 is connected to the back of the cup 422, and the other end of the pull rod 423 penetrates through the cup support 421 and is connected to a suction pick 424 capable of driving the pull rod 423 to move up and down.
An eccentric shaft 425 is provided at the end of the suction paddle 424, and the pull rod 423 is connected to the eccentric shaft 425, so that the turning motion of the suction paddle 424 drives the axial motion of the pull rod 423.
Compare in ordinary plastic sucking disc, the adsorption efficiency of air exhaust type sucking disc 42 is better, can effectively avoid marking dropping of panel 10, air exhaust type sucking disc 42's absorption principle is similar with current glass sucking disc's principle, and the upset through pumping-out plectrum 424 drives pull rod 423 and reciprocates, when pull rod 423 rebound, because pull rod 423 and sucking disc 422's back fixed connection, consequently drive sucking disc 422's back kickup and form a negative pressure cavity and make sucking disc 422 closely adsorb on treating the stationary plane. On the contrary, when the pull rod 423 moves downwards, the negative pressure is eliminated, so that the suction cup body 422 can be separated from the surface to be fixed, and the picking of the safety signboard is realized.
In addition, when the indication panel 10 is attached to the glass display screen or the window on the surface of the device mechanism, the indication panel 10 blocks a certain observation surface, so that the inside of the device cannot be directly observed, the embodiment of the present invention also performs a special design on the indication panel 10, specifically:
as shown in fig. 2, the indication panel 10 includes a movable plate 11 and fixing strips 12 disposed at two ends of the movable plate 11, the magnet strips 30, the suspension holes 13 and the movable suction cups 40 are uniformly distributed on the fixing strips 12, slots 121 are disposed at side edges of the fixing strips 12, and two ends of the movable plate 11 are inserted into the slots 121 through the insertion blocks 111 and can slide upwards along the slots 121.
The fixed strip 12 is fixedly installed on the glass surface relative to the movable plate 11 with a narrow width, the shielding area of the fixed strip is small, the movable plate 11 can slide upwards along the slot 121 on the side surface of the fixed strip 12 for a certain distance or be completely taken out, the observation surface of the glass window can be released, and the internal condition of the device can be directly observed.
In order to facilitate observation at night, the movable plate 11 includes a foam base plate 112 and a PVC film 113 printed with a hollow logo, the front surface of the foam base plate 112 is provided with a fluorescent coating, and the PVC film 113 is adhered to the fluorescent coating of the foam base plate 112.
When the PVC film 113 is adhered to the fluorescent coating surface of the foam base plate 112, the fluorescent coating forms the ground color of the hollow position, so that the night vision effect can be enhanced, and meanwhile, the PVC film 113 can be directly replaced when the logo needs to be replaced, so that the PVC film 113 coated on the foam base plate 112 has the fluorescent effect.
In the embodiment of the present invention, the length and width of the indication panel 10 applied to the electric power safety indication are 200mm, the thickness is 3mm, the thickness of the magnet strip 30 is 1mm, the width is 20mm, and the length is 180mm, and the specific dimensions of the indication panel 10 and the magnet strip 30 can be adaptively modified according to different application environments.
